Output e622afe9504f8c6b1a65082bd5ef2a03c17979ac7ecf86b0ad8a24ca3d0fe664:0

value
2435432
script pubkey
OP_0 OP_PUSHBYTES_20 cc809636fdc1039404554e5ec6038195ec47e16f
address
bc1qejqfvdhacypegpz4fe0vvqupjhky0ct0xwlxyp
transaction
e622afe9504f8c6b1a65082bd5ef2a03c17979ac7ecf86b0ad8a24ca3d0fe664
spent
true